ADVANCED DATA MODELING WITH IDEA
Transcript of ADVANCED DATA MODELING WITH IDEA
![Page 1: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/1.jpg)
ADVANCED DATA MODELING WITH IDEA
VIEW ON DATA STRUCTURES
![Page 2: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/2.jpg)
WHO AM I?
• BERT DINGEMANS
• DATA ARCHITECT WITH A FOCUS ON
BIG DATA AND DATA MODELING (IN EA)
• ZZP (INDEPENDENT CONSULTANT) IN
THE DEMAND GROUP
• W: WWW.EAXPERTISE.NL
• M: [email protected]
![Page 3: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/3.jpg)
EXTRA INFORMATION
• AUTHOR OF THE BOOK “DATA
ARCHITECTUUR IN DE PRAKTIJK”
AND “DATA MODELLEREN IN DE
PRAKTIJK”
• TRAINER TFG ACADEMY AND
ITMG DATA ARCHITECTURE AND
BIG DATA
• TRAINING PARTNER FOR SPARX
EA
• PARTICIPANT IN EAXPERTISE.NL
![Page 4: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/4.jpg)
APPROACH OF TODAY
• IDEA BEHIND IDEA
• COMMUNITY
• SAMPLE REPO, SCRIPTS AND
ADDON
• INSTALLATION
• VIEWPOINTS
• HELPERS
• PACKAGE
• DIAGRAM
• ELEMENT
• ARCHIMAID & NO DATA FAULT
WINDOWS
• SCRIPTS
• DEDUPLICATOR
• TEAM AWARE MODELLING
• RELEASE MANAGEMENT
![Page 5: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/5.jpg)
IDEA COMMUNITY
• IDEA IS AN OPEN SOURCE INITIATIVE IN THE NETHERLANDS
• A NUMBER OF ORGANISATIONS IS PARTICIPATING IN THE
FUNCTIONALITIES DEVELOPED
• SOLUTIONS ARE AVAILABLE AS ADDON, SCRIPTS, EXAMPLES,
WEBVIDEOS AND AN MDG
• MORE INFORMATION: HTTP://EAXPERTISE.NL/IDEAEN.ASPX
![Page 6: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/6.jpg)
MODELING AND VIEWPOINTS
Production
Storage
Integration/
transportUsage
Physical
datamodel
Mappings
Logical
datamodel
Archimate
Conceptual
model
Conceptual
model
Physical
datamodel
![Page 7: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/7.jpg)
LOGICAL FUNCTIONS IN A DATA MODEL?
StructureSecurity Datamanagement
Conceptual
datamodel
Logical datamodel
Physical datamodel
Data governance
Data quality
Data usage
Data security
Data privacy
Data autorisaties
![Page 8: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/8.jpg)
Structure
WHAT ARE VIEWPOINTS FOR EEN DATA REGISTER?
Security Datamanagement
Data governance
Data quality
Data usage
Data security
Data privacy
Data authorisation
ArchiMate
motivation
ArchiMate
motivation
CRUD
matrixArchiMate
Core
Score
Matrix
RACI
matrix
Conceptual
datamodel
Logical datamodel
Physical datamodel
ArchiMate
Passive
Structure
UML
ERD/XSD
![Page 9: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/9.jpg)
DOWNLOADS
• FOR THE SESSION WE USE AN EAP WITH A STRUCTURE AND SCRIPTS
AND INSTALL THE
• IN THIS SESSION WE ARE GOING TO CREATE A MODEL IN THIS EAP
AND USE THE SETUP (RUN THE EXE AS ADMINISTRATOR)
http://eaxpertise.nl/upload/idea_trainingen.zip
http://eaxpertise.nl/upload/ideasetup.exe (or .zip)
Demo of the EAP
content
![Page 10: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/10.jpg)
DATA MODELING HELPERS
• ELEMENT
• DIAGRAM
• PACKAGE
![Page 11: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/11.jpg)
ARCHIMAID AND NO DATA FAULT
![Page 12: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/12.jpg)
SCRIPTS
![Page 13: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/13.jpg)
DEDUPLICATOR
• WARNING SCREENS
• PACKAGE DEDUPLICATOR
![Page 14: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/14.jpg)
TEAM AWARE MODELING
![Page 15: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/15.jpg)
RELEASE MANAGER
![Page 16: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/16.jpg)
MORE INFORMATION
• HTTP://EAXPERTISE.NL/IDEAEN.ASPX
• HTTP://EAXPERTISE.NL/WPPEN.ASPX
• HTTPS://YOUTU.BE/1PZNLINSYJW
![Page 17: ADVANCED DATA MODELING WITH IDEA](https://reader031.fdocuments.us/reader031/viewer/2022012503/617ce99590d8a03b68761586/html5/thumbnails/17.jpg)
DISCUSSION
DO THESE MODELING TECHNIQUES AND THEIR
INTEGRATION HELP
ARE THIS THE RIGHT TECHNIQUES COMBINED?